Unlocking Potential: Key Advantages of Hands-on Education for Kids

Hands-on education is a powerful tool for helping kids learn and grow.

When children are actively involved in their learning, they build deeper understanding and retain information more effectively. Research show that hands-on activities can boost problem-solving skills, creativity, and critical thinking.

  • Kids learn by doing! Hands-on activities capture their attention and make learning fun.
  • Lessons come to life when children can interact real objects and materials.
  • Hands-on education stimulates collaboration and teamwork as kids work together to solve problems and achieve goals.

By providing opportunities for exploration and discovery, hands-on education empowers children to become lifelong learners who are confident and ready to meet the challenges of the future.

Making Learning Fun: Interactive Activities That Boost Child Engagement

Learning doesn't have to be a bore! Kids thrive when they are engaged in fun and interactive activities. Move beyond traditional lectures and opt for activities that spark curiosity and fuel a love of learning.

A few easy ideas include:

  • Playing pretend historical events or literary scenes
  • Constructing models or structures related to a topic
  • Planning field trips to museums, science centers
  • Engaging in educational games or puzzles
  • Using technology for interactive activities

By adding these engaging activities into your child's learning journey, you can help them to become more eager learners. Remember, learning should be a pleasant experience!
